Fast Look at the Cast
Below is a quick summary of the main actors forming the current Eastenders cast:
- Gillian Taylforth: Portrays Kathy Cotton, a long-standing character.
- Letitia Dean: Plays Sharon Watts, whose role has been pivotal over the years.
- Adam Woodyatt: Brings Ian Beale to life with authenticity.
- Alice Haig: Steps into a significant role as Vicki Fowler.
Other veterans and returning stars include Steve McFadden as Phil Mitchell, and Ross Kemp as Grant Mitchell, who returns for the anniversary celebrations. Additionally, new characters like Councillor Donald Barker (Iain Fletcher) and Julia Fowler enrich the storyline while paying homage to established family legacies.
